Sheet erosion, Pullman, Washington, 1946. Sheet erosion or sheet wash is the even erosion of substrate along a wide area. It occurs in a wide range of settings such as coastal plains, hillslopes, floodplains, beaches, savanna plains and semi-arid plains. sheet erosion noun : erosion that removes surface material more or less evenly from an extensive area as contrasted with erosion along well-defined drainage lines that produces or enlarges gullies or ravines Love words?

What Is Sheet ErosionSheet erosion refers to the uniform detachment and removal of soil, or sediment particles from the soil surface by overland flow or raindrop impact evenly distributed across a slope (Hairsine and Rose, 1992a). From: Environmental Modelling & Software, 2003. Sheet erosion is the uniform removal of soil in thin layers and it occurs when soil particles are carried evenly over the soil surface by rainwater that does not infiltrate into the ground The sediments in this runoff can also fill in cracks in the soil surface creating an impervious crust that further reduces water infiltration
